From c1cf191a66f555b1313f8faca1eaaef1f59e36bc Mon Sep 17 00:00:00 2001 From: Maarten van der Heide Date: Wed, 10 Jul 2013 10:06:17 +0000 Subject: [PATCH] ALLV#23264 PRS-import svn path=/Customer/trunk/; revision=18423 --- ALLV/Once/allv5.sql | 139 ++++++++++++++++++++++++++++++++++++++++++++ 1 file changed, 139 insertions(+) create mode 100644 ALLV/Once/allv5.sql diff --git a/ALLV/Once/allv5.sql b/ALLV/Once/allv5.sql new file mode 100644 index 000000000..b5a8ba51b --- /dev/null +++ b/ALLV/Once/allv5.sql @@ -0,0 +1,139 @@ +-- Customer specific once-script ALLV5. +-- +-- (c) 2013 SG|facilitor bv +-- $Revision$ +-- $Id$ +-- +-- Support: +31 53 4800700 +SET ECHO ON +SPOOL xallv5.lst +SET DEFINE OFF + +/* Formatted on 29-3-2013 17:48:24 (QP5 v5.115.810.9015) */ +CREATE TABLE allv_imp_prs +( + imp_datum DATE, + prs_perslid_nr VARCHAR2 (50), + --prs_perslid_titel VARCHAR2 (15), + prs_perslid_naam VARCHAR2 (30), + prs_perslid_tussenvoegsel VARCHAR2 (15), + prs_perslid_voorletters VARCHAR2 (10), + prs_perslid_voornaam VARCHAR2 (30), + prs_perslid_geslacht NUMBER (1), + --prs_afdeling_naam VARCHAR2 (10), + --prs_afdeling_omschrijving VARCHAR2 (60), + prs_kostenplaats_nr VARCHAR2 (30), + prs_srtperslid_omschrijving VARCHAR2 (60), + --alg_locatie_code VARCHAR2 (10), + alg_gebouw_code VARCHAR2 (12), + --alg_verdieping_code VARCHAR2 (10), + alg_ruimte_nr VARCHAR2 (10), + prs_perslid_telefoonnr VARCHAR2 (15), + prs_perslid_mobiel VARCHAR2 (15), + prs_perslid_email VARCHAR2 (50), + prs_perslid_oslogin VARCHAR2 (30), + prs_perslid_ingangsdatum DATE, + prs_perslid_einddatum DATE +); + +/* Formatted on 2-4-2013 10:48:52 (QP5 v5.115.810.9015) */ +INSERT INTO fac_import_app (fac_import_app_code, + fac_import_app_oms, + fac_functie_key, + fac_import_app_prefix) + SELECT 'PRS', + 'Import persoonsgegevens', + fac_functie_key, + 'ALLV' + FROM fac_functie + WHERE fac_functie_code = 'WEB_PRSSYS'; + +CREATE OR REPLACE VIEW allv_v_rap_import_log AS SELECT NULL x FROM DUAL; +-- Beheer:Gebruikersbeheer-rapport = 57 +INSERT INTO FAC_USRRAP + (fac_usrrap_omschrijving, fac_usrrap_view_name, + fac_usrrap_in_huidige_locatie, + fac_usrrap_template, fac_usrrap_macro, + fac_usrrap_vraagbegindatum, fac_usrrap_vraageinddatum, + fac_usrrap_functie, + fac_usrrap_info, + fac_functie_key, fac_usrrap_autorefresh + ) + VALUES ('BEHEER: Personen import resutaat', 'allv_v_rap_import_log', + NULL, + NULL, NULL, + 0, 0, + 0, + 'E=Error/Fout | W=Waarschuwing | I=Informatie | S=Samenvatting.', + 57, + 0 + ); + +CREATE OR REPLACE VIEW ALLV_V_RAP_EXT_ORDERS_EXP AS SELECT NULL x FROM DUAL; +-- Beheer:Gebruikersbeheer-rapport = 57 +INSERT INTO FAC_USRRAP + (fac_usrrap_omschrijving, fac_usrrap_view_name, + fac_usrrap_in_huidige_locatie, + fac_usrrap_template, fac_usrrap_macro, + fac_usrrap_vraagbegindatum, fac_usrrap_vraageinddatum, + fac_usrrap_functie, + fac_usrrap_info, + fac_functie_key, fac_usrrap_autorefresh + ) + VALUES ('Exportbestand externe orders (door leverancier geleverd)', 'ALLV_V_RAP_EXT_ORDERS_EXP', + NULL, + NULL, NULL, + 0, 0, + 0, + 'Externe orders (geleverd).', + 57, + 0 + ); + +CREATE OR REPLACE VIEW ALLV_V_RAP_INT_ORDERS_EXP AS SELECT NULL x FROM DUAL; +-- Beheer:Gebruikersbeheer-rapport = 57 +INSERT INTO FAC_USRRAP + (fac_usrrap_omschrijving, fac_usrrap_view_name, + fac_usrrap_in_huidige_locatie, + fac_usrrap_template, fac_usrrap_macro, + fac_usrrap_vraagbegindatum, fac_usrrap_vraageinddatum, + fac_usrrap_functie, + fac_usrrap_info, + fac_functie_key, fac_usrrap_autorefresh + ) + VALUES ('Exportbestand interne orders (uit voorraad geleverd)', 'ALLV_V_RAP_INT_ORDERS_EXP', + NULL, + NULL, NULL, + 0, 0, + 0, + 'Interne orders (geleverd).', + 57, + 0 + ); + +/* Formatted on 15-2-2013 10:36:42 (QP5 v5.115.810.9015) */ +--INSERT INTO fac_import_app (fac_import_app_code, +-- fac_import_app_oms, +-- fac_functie_key, +-- fac_import_app_prefix, +-- fac_import_app_xsl, +-- fac_import_app_folder, +-- fac_import_app_files, +-- fac_import_app_charset) +-- SELECT 'FACTUUR', +-- 'Xtractor: import facturenbestand', +-- fac_functie_key, +-- 'ALLV', +-- 'xsl/fclt_import_xtractor.xsl', +-- 'd:/Apps/Facilitor/ftp_sites/LocalUser/ALLVFtp/XTRACTOR_TEST', +-- '*.xml', +-- 'UTF-8' +-- FROM fac_functie +-- WHERE fac_functie_code = 'WEB_FINFOF'; + +COMMIT; + +BEGIN adm.systrackscript('$Workfile: allv5.sql $', '$Revision$', 1); END; +/ +SPOOL OFF +@allv.sql